Output 77fb6171ed781316bc20b19d2629ca4da9a0eeee6c13d139ef486f625c794182:0

value
380451000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f7e151a9d21eec6ccfe04a0575e5dd5d648867a OP_EQUALVERIFY OP_CHECKSIG
address
LLdsSTA6Q5QEaxYqkwHjzGL94WMJzcxFx3
transaction
77fb6171ed781316bc20b19d2629ca4da9a0eeee6c13d139ef486f625c794182
spent
true